不同整地施肥措施对银杏构件生长及药用成分的影响

摘要: 研究了田间条件下不同整地施肥措施对银杏构件生长及药用成分的影响.结果表明,对银杏株高生长促进作用最大的措施依次为:施农家肥+间作>爆破整地+间作>施农家肥>爆破整地>间作,提高生长量分别为14.5%、8.6%、5.7%、3.2%和0;对银杏当年新梢生长促进作用最大的措施依次为:施农家肥+间作>爆破整地+间作>间作>施农家肥>爆破整地,提高生长量分别为58.1%、36.6%、33.1%、30.2%和14.0%;不同的整地、施肥和间作措施样地长枝数无显著差异,而短枝数量与总叶数有显著差异;施农家肥加间作措施对提高银杏药用成分含量作用最大,叶片中檞皮素和芦丁含量分别为对照的4.2倍和2.2倍.

Abstract: The study showed that the efficiency of various treatments in improving the height growth of Ginkgo biloba was organic fertilizer plus intercropping>soil preparation by blasting plus intercropping>organic fertilizer>soil preparation by blasting>intercropping,and the height growth increased by 14.5%,8.6%,5.7%,3.2% and 0,respectively.The efficiency of the treatments in improving new shoot growth was organic fertilizer plus intercropping>soil preparation by blasting plus intercropping>intercropping>organic fertilizer>soil preparation by blasting,and the new shoot growth increased by 58.1%,36.6%,33.1%,30.2% and 14.0%,respectively.Soil preparation,organic fertilization and intercropping had no different effect on the number of long shoots,but their effect on the numbers of short shoots and leaves was significantly different.The most efficient treatment in improving the medicine content was organic fertilization plus intercropping.Compared with control,the content of quercetin and rutin in Ginkgo biloba leaves increased by 420% and 220%,respectively.
